您现在的位置是:首页 > PLC技术 > PLC技术
欧姆龙CQM1H系列PLC的移位寄存器指令(SFT(10))
来源:艾特贸易2017-06-04
简介SFT 指令的梯形图符号及可用的操作数如图 4.31 所示,其中, E 应大于或等于 St , St 和 E 必须在同一数据区。如果 E= St ,则产生一个 16 位的移位寄存器。 图 4. 31 SFT 的梯形图符号及操
SFT指令的梯形图符号及可用的操作数如图4.31所示,其中,E应大于或等于St,St和E必须在同一数据区。如果E= St,则产生一个16位的移位寄存器。
图4. 31 SFT的梯形图符号及操作数数据区
SFT(10)由三个执行条件控制,即数据输入端IN,移位脉冲端SP和复位端R。当复位端R为OFF时,只有在移位脉冲端SP由OFF→ON的上升沿,St到E通道中的所有位依次向高位移一位,E通道的最高位溢出丢失,而St通道的最低位由数据输入端IN的状态来决定,如图4. 32所示。当复位端R为ON时,从St到E通道中的所有位将为OFF,此时,移位脉冲端和数据输入端无效。
图4. 32 SFT指令的执行示意图
SFT编写语句表时,应依次先编数据输入端、移位脉冲端、复位端,最后编SFT指令。